共同アプリ開発: チームワークが夢を実現する

AgilePoint は、初期の頃から、最も要求の厳しい多機能自動化ユースケースに対応できるプラットフォームとして知られてきました。しかし、AgilePoint が真価を発揮したのはバージョン 7、特にバージョン 8 の頃だと考えています。今では完全な製品であり、お客様が大規模な多機能自動化を構築できる完全なパッケージになっています。数千のアプリ、数千のプロセス ステップ、それに付随する多数のフォームが揃っています。

途中で開発パラダイムが変化し、チームが大きくなり、気付かないうちにさまざまな開発者が参加するようになりました。アプリの整合性を確保し、互換性を破る変更が発生しないようにするために、1 人のアプリ デザイナーが変更を加えると、プラットフォームはアプリ全体をロックします。これは優れた安全策ではありましたが、特に最も複雑なソリューションの場合は障害になることもあり得ました。AgilePoint v9 の登場により、このような状況はなくなりました。

共同アプリ開発とはどのようなものですか?

すでにお分かりかと思いますが、これは、アプリケーションのさまざまな部分を並行して作業しようとする大規模なチームが直面する重大なハードルを克服するのに役立ち、同僚とリアルタイムで共同作業することで、次のアプリケーションの価値実現までの時間をさらに短縮することを約束します。

しかし、まだこれをオンにしたくない場合はどうすればよいでしょうか?

心配しないでください。プラットフォームの他のすべてと同様に、ユーザーに公開するプラットフォーム機能を決定するのはお客様です。このため、この機能をグローバルおよびアプリケーションごとにオン/オフにできる柔軟性を提供します。

素晴らしいですね!でも、もっと詳しい情報が必要です!

人生の他のことと同様、従う必要のあるルールや細則があります。以下に主な部分を説明します。

プロセスが 1 人のユーザーによって編集用にロックされている場合、セカンダリ アプリ デザイナーの次の機能がブロックされます。

  • プロセスデータモデルの変更
  • ライブラリの編集
  • データソースの作成/編集

eFormが編集用にロックされている場合は、

  • 新しいコントロールの追加
  • コントロールをライブラリに昇格
  • データソースのマッピング
  • データグリッド/リストビュー構成を編集

ほら?髪の毛を抜かないようにするためのちょっとしたコツです。残った髪の毛はそのままにしておきたいという人もいるでしょう!

それでは、この機能の実際の動作を短いビデオで見てみましょう。(※動画の音声は英語です。)

注: このビデオは、この機能がベータ版である間に録画されたものであることに注意してください。一部のラベルとアイコンは、GA になるまでに変更される可能性がありますが、これらのアクティビティを構成する一般的な概念は同じままです。

コメント